Bruce Lester

Biography

Bruce Lester

Overview

  • Born
    June 6, 1912 · Johannesburg, South Africa
  • Died
    June 13, 2008 · Los Angeles, California, USA (undisclosed)
  • Birth name
    Bruce Somerset Lister

Mini bio

  • Bruce Lester was born on June 6, 1912 in Johannesburg, South Africa. He was an actor and writer, known for Pride and Prejudice (1940), The Letter (1940) and Shadows on the Stairs (1941). He was married to Jane Crane and Eileen Mary Scott. He died on June 13, 2008 in Los Angeles, California, USA.

Trivia

  • Later worked for Columbia and Paramount studios as a story analyst.
  • His career was interrupted by WWII. He served in the Army and returned to acting and films in Hollywood after the war.
  • In later years he and his wife Jane divided their time between homes in Los Angeles and Palm Springs, which enabled him to play tennis and enjoy the Hollywood Cricket Club.
  • Attended Brighton College in England where he showed expertise as a tennis player.
  • Changed his last name from Lister to Lester when he went to Hollywood.

Quotes

  • [Speaking about his experience working on the 1940 theatrical film, Pride and Prejudice, in which he played Mr. Bingley] It was the biggest budget of my career and one that brought with it my own dresser, a bungalow on the lot and lunches where one could spot Greta Garbo, Salvador Dalí, Cary Grant and dozens of Munchkins from The Wizard of Oz (1939).
